Senior Python Developer

hace 2 semanas


Barcelona, Barcelona, España BMAT Music Innovators A tiempo completo
About BMAT Music Innovators

BMAT Music Innovators is a pioneering company that has been at the forefront of music technology since 2005. Our team of passionate engineers and music enthusiasts has grown to over 200 people across the globe, united by our mission to make music live forever.

Job Title: Senior Python Developer

We're seeking a highly skilled Senior Python Developer to lead our Pronto engineering product, a SaaS platform that ingests and processes massive amounts of music data from digital service providers. As a key member of our team, you'll be responsible for designing and implementing distributed systems, working with our tech stack, and collaborating with our engineering team to drive innovation and growth.

Key Responsibilities:
  • Design and implement distributed systems using Python and AWS
  • Work closely with our engineering team to drive innovation and growth
  • Collaborate with our data team to develop and maintain our data pipeline
  • Develop and maintain our Pronto engineering product
  • Contribute to the development of our tech stack and architecture
Requirements:
  • 6+ years of experience as a software engineer
  • 2+ years of experience in a leadership role
  • Strong knowledge of Python and AWS
  • Experience with SQL databases (PostgreSQL)
  • Experience with async Python code (asyncio)
  • Experience with designing and implementing distributed systems
  • Excellent communication and leadership skills
What We Offer:
  • Flexible working hours and location
  • Unlimited time off
  • Flat hierarchy
  • Online language classes
  • Online and onsite courses and music industry workshops
  • Barcelona HQ office available

We're an equal opportunities employer and welcome applications from diverse backgrounds and perspectives. If you're passionate about music and technology, and you're looking for a challenging and rewarding role, we'd love to hear from you.



  • Barcelona, Barcelona, España Yantech Associates A tiempo completo

    Job Title: Senior Python EngineerYantech Associates has partnered with a leading software consultancy with teams across Europe. They are seeking multiple backend Python software engineers to work on a hybrid basis in their Barcelona office.Job Description:As a senior Python engineer, you will be working on fast-paced projects for clients and ensuring best...


  • Barcelona, Barcelona, España Yantech Associates A tiempo completo

    Job Title: Senior Python EngineerYantech Associates has partnered with a leading software consultancy with teams across Europe. They are seeking multiple backend Python software engineers to work on a hybrid basis in their Barcelona office.Job Description:As a senior Python engineer, you will be working on fast-paced projects for clients and ensuring best...


  • Barcelona, Barcelona, España Teqniksoft A tiempo completo

    Pivotal Role: Senior Python DeveloperWe are seeking an experienced Python Developer/Team Lead to join our cross-cultural technical team at Teqniksoft and build efficient server-side applications for one of the biggest retail vendors in Mexico.Key Responsibilities:Participate in all phases of the software development lifecycle and mentor team members.Help...


  • Barcelona, Barcelona, España Teqniksoft A tiempo completo

    Pivotal Role: Senior Python DeveloperWe are seeking an experienced Python Developer/Team Lead to join our cross-cultural technical team at Teqniksoft and build efficient server-side applications for one of the biggest retail vendors in Mexico.Key Responsibilities:Participate in all phases of the software development lifecycle and mentor team members.Help...


  • Barcelona, Barcelona, España Lengow A tiempo completo

    Senior Python DeveloperWe are seeking a highly skilled and experienced Senior Python Developer to join our team at Lengow. The ideal candidate will have extensive experience in Python development, a deep understanding of clean architecture principles, and a strong background in CI/CD practices, particularly using GitHub Actions and ArgoCD.Key...


  • Barcelona, Barcelona, España Lengow A tiempo completo

    Senior Python DeveloperWe are seeking a highly skilled and experienced Senior Python Developer to join our team at Lengow. The ideal candidate will have extensive experience in Python development, a deep understanding of clean architecture principles, and a strong background in CI/CD practices, particularly using GitHub Actions and ArgoCD.Key...


  • Barcelona, Barcelona, España Multiplica Talent A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Python Developer to join our team at Multiplica Talent. As a key member of our backend team, you will be responsible for designing, developing, and maintaining high-quality client experiences.Key ResponsibilitiesCollaborate with the backend team and other departments to build scalable and efficient...


  • Barcelona, Barcelona, España Multiplica Talent A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Python Developer to join our team at Multiplica Talent. As a key member of our backend team, you will be responsible for designing, developing, and maintaining high-quality client experiences.Key ResponsibilitiesCollaborate with the backend team and other departments to build scalable and efficient...

  • Senior Python Developer

    hace 2 semanas


    Barcelona, Barcelona, España Multiplica Talent A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Python Developer to join our team at Multiplica Talent. As a key member of our backend team, you will be responsible for designing, developing, and maintaining high-quality client experiences.Key ResponsibilitiesCollaborate with the backend team and other departments to build scalable and efficient backend...

  • Senior Python Developer

    hace 2 semanas


    Barcelona, Barcelona, España Multiplica Talent A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Python Developer to join our team at Multiplica Talent. As a key member of our backend team, you will be responsible for designing, developing, and maintaining high-quality client experiences.Key ResponsibilitiesCollaborate with the backend team and other departments to build scalable and efficient backend...


  • Barcelona, Barcelona, España YanTech Associates A tiempo completo

    Job Title: Senior Python EngineerAbout the Role:We are seeking an experienced Senior Python Engineer to join our team at YanTech Associates. As a Senior Python Engineer, you will be working on fast-paced projects for our clients, ensuring best coding practices and collaborating with our experienced team.Key Responsibilities:Design and develop high-quality...


  • Barcelona, Barcelona, España YanTech Associates A tiempo completo

    Job Title: Senior Python EngineerAbout the Role:We are seeking an experienced Senior Python Engineer to join our team at YanTech Associates. As a Senior Python Engineer, you will be working on fast-paced projects for our clients, ensuring best coding practices and collaborating with our experienced team.Key Responsibilities:Design and develop high-quality...

  • Senior Python Developer

    hace 4 semanas


    Barcelona, Barcelona, España YanTech Associates A tiempo completo

    Software Engineer OpportunityYanTech Associates has partnered with a leading software consultancy with teams across Europe. They are searching for multiple backend Python software engineers to work on a hybrid basis in their Barcelona office.About the RoleYou will be working on fast-paced projects for clients and ensuring best coding practices. The team is...

  • Senior Python Developer

    hace 4 semanas


    Barcelona, Barcelona, España YanTech Associates A tiempo completo

    Software Engineer OpportunityYanTech Associates has partnered with a leading software consultancy with teams across Europe. They are searching for multiple backend Python software engineers to work on a hybrid basis in their Barcelona office.About the RoleYou will be working on fast-paced projects for clients and ensuring best coding practices. The team is...


  • Barcelona, Barcelona, España Yantech Associates A tiempo completo

    Yantech Associates has partnered with a leading software consultancy with teams across Europe.We are searching for multiple backend Python software engineers to work on a hybrid basis in our Barcelona office.You will be working on fast-paced projects for our clients and ensuring best coding practices.The team is all super experienced and has a great culture,...


  • Barcelona, Barcelona, España Yantech Associates A tiempo completo

    Yantech Associates has partnered with a leading software consultancy with teams across Europe.We are searching for multiple backend Python software engineers to work on a hybrid basis in our Barcelona office.You will be working on fast-paced projects for our clients and ensuring best coding practices.The team is all super experienced and has a great culture,...


  • Barcelona, Barcelona, España European Bartender School A tiempo completo

    About the RoleWe are seeking a highly skilled Full Stack Python Developer to join our development team in Barcelona. As a key member of our team, you will be responsible for designing, developing, and deploying robust applications using Python, Django, and MySQL.Key ResponsibilitiesDesign and develop scalable and efficient web applications using Python,...


  • Barcelona, Barcelona, España European Bartender School A tiempo completo

    About the RoleWe are seeking a highly skilled Full Stack Python Developer to join our development team in Barcelona. As a key member of our team, you will be responsible for designing, developing, and deploying robust applications using Python, Django, and MySQL.Key ResponsibilitiesDesign and develop scalable and efficient web applications using Python,...


  • Barcelona, Barcelona, España Zurich Insurance A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Python AWS Developer to join our team in Barcelona. As a key member of our Squad, you will be responsible for setting up, maintaining, and evolving our cloud infrastructure in AWS, as well as building clean and efficient back-end features in Python.Key ResponsibilitiesDesign and implement scalable and...


  • Barcelona, Barcelona, España Zurich Insurance A tiempo completo

    About the RoleWe are seeking a highly skilled Senior Python AWS Developer to join our team in Barcelona. As a key member of our Squad, you will be responsible for setting up, maintaining, and evolving our cloud infrastructure in AWS, as well as building clean and efficient back-end features in Python.Key ResponsibilitiesDesign and implement scalable and...